WebMar 17, 2024 · The Domestic Abuse (Protection) (Scotland) Bill will enable police and courts to ban suspected abusers from re-entering the home and from approaching or contacting the person at risk for a period of time to enable them to consider their longer-term options around safety and housing. The latest Recorded Crime National Statistics show that there were 1,760 crimes recorded under the Domestic Abuse (Scotland) Act 2024 in 2024-22.
